Youth Unemployment Rate in Greece increased to 21 percent in March from 17.90 percent in February of 2026. Youth Unemployment Rate in Greece averaged 34.27 percent from 1998 until 2026, reaching an all time high of 61.40 percent in June of 2013 and a record low of 14.30 percent in December of 2025. source: EUROSTAT

Youth Unemployment Rate in Greece is expected to be 19.60 percent by the end of this quarter, according to Trading Economics global macro models and analysts expectations. In the long-term, the Greece Youth Unemployment Rate is projected to trend around 20.20 percent in 2027 and 19.80 percent in 2028, according to our econometric models.
